From the esteemed Qashghai tribal weavers of Fars province in SW Persia, this rustic scatter shows two rows each of … Read more From the esteemed Qashghai tribal weavers of Fars province in SW Persia, this rustic scatter shows two rows each of small, ecru dogs facing right and two rows of plump birds in the same configuration. Probably chickens reds to eat. No borders on the abashed charcoal field. Essential animals for the tribes folk. Wool from the weaver's own flocks. Good plus condition. See less
